Oil Cleaning Methods. The most common oils used are castor oil and olive oil, though you can use any natural oil. What is the oil cleansing method, and how does it work? The oil cleansing method (ocm) uses natural oils to cleanse your skin. Cleansing oils can be more hydrating than traditional face washes because they don’t contain many surfactants (or any, depending on the product), new york city dermatologist doris. This makes it ideal for oily or combination skin (and even dry skin in lesser amounts).
